Detailed Solution

Canals, wells, tanks, and artificial lakes were constructed for better irrigation. The process of providing water to plants in a regulated way and at regular intervals is known as irrigation. It is a synthetic method of watering the ground to facilitate crop growth. Canals are artificial waterways. In many aspects, these canals are beneficial for irrigation. By excavating the ground, wells are made to provide access to water supplies. Water is kept in water tanks as well. Another significant source of water is man-made reservoirs called artificial lakes. This can be used to store water for irrigation.
